Please tell me the procedure to upgrade the IOS on Cisco switches using LMS 3.1
04-27-2010 10:32 PM
The specifics will depend on the exact switch type. However, in general, you go to RME > Software Management > Software Repository, and first make sure the desired image is in the repository. If not, you can add it from Cisco.com, the local server's file system, or from a device in the network. Once the image is in the repo, go to Software Distribution, and start a deployment job either by device or by image. Select the device and image, fill in the appropriate options, and RME will do the rest for you. Along the way, you can consult the context-sensitive online help for more information on each step.

Needs to know before upgrading the IOS on switches, how to take the backup of the config using LMS.
04-27-2010 10:48 PM
Go to RME > Config Mgmt > Archive Mgmt > Sync Archive, and run a sync job against the switch in question. If it completes successfully, then RME will have the latest version of the switch's configuration in its archive.
